“Do you think there are spaces catering to the happily middle-aged feminist online?” This is the question that stuck out to Tami and me after we took part in a Tweetchat about intergenerational feminism. As much as she knew, Tami said, --that 40-something women participate in digital feminism --that digital feminism gave us outlets to hone our thinking about feminism, --and that women of color like bell hooks specifically deeply influenced the “intersectional feminism” that’s gaining traction with feminists younger than we are–especially the white ones, sites where Black feminists and other feminists of color our age can stay honing our feminism are quickly narrowing. The feminist, even the Black ones, sites are geared towards feminist who are, at oldest, 30-something. And, except for a few blogs run by individuals, “I’m not sure that black media, even black media directed toward women, has embraced feminism,” Tami mused. Thus…this blog, which premieres Sunday, 9/15!
